全面解析科学上网工具Shadowsocks

什么是Shadowsocks?

Shadowsocks 是一种开源的代理工具,广泛用于科学上网。它通过加密用户的网络流量,帮助用户绕过网络限制,访问被屏蔽的网站。Shadowsocks的设计初衷是为了提供一个简单而有效的方式来保护用户的隐私和安全。

Shadowsocks的工作原理

Shadowsocks的工作原理基于代理服务器和加密技术。用户的网络请求首先被发送到Shadowsocks代理服务器,代理服务器再将请求转发到目标网站。整个过程通过加密技术保护用户的隐私,确保数据在传输过程中不被窃取。

主要特点

  • 高效性:Shadowsocks使用轻量级的协议,能够提供快速的连接速度。
  • 安全性:通过加密技术,用户的网络流量得以保护,防止被监控。
  • 灵活性:支持多种平台,包括Windows、macOS、Linux、Android和iOS。

如何安装Shadowsocks

Windows系统安装

  1. 下载Shadowsocks客户端。
  2. 解压缩下载的文件并运行Shadowsocks.exe。
  3. 在客户端中输入服务器地址、端口和密码。
  4. 点击“连接”按钮,完成安装。

macOS系统安装

  1. 从官方网站下载ShadowsocksX-NG客户端。
  2. 将应用程序拖入“应用程序”文件夹。
  3. 启动ShadowsocksX-NG,输入服务器信息。
  4. 点击“连接”以开始使用。

Android和iOS系统安装

  • 在应用商店搜索“Shadowsocks”,下载并安装。
  • 打开应用,输入服务器信息,点击“连接”。

Shadowsocks的配置教程

配置基本设置

  • 服务器地址:输入你的Shadowsocks服务器的IP地址。
  • 端口:输入服务器的端口号。
  • 密码:设置一个强密码以保护你的连接。
  • 加密方式:选择合适的加密方式,推荐使用AES-256-GCM。

高级配置

  • UDP转发:如果需要使用UDP协议,可以在设置中启用UDP转发。
  • 自定义规则:可以根据需要设置访问规则,选择哪些流量走代理。

常见问题解答(FAQ)

Shadowsocks安全吗?

Shadowsocks 提供了良好的安全性,通过加密技术保护用户的网络流量,防止数据被窃取。然而,用户仍需注意选择可信的服务器提供商。

如何选择Shadowsocks服务器?

选择服务器时,可以考虑以下几点:

  • 速度:选择延迟低、速度快的服务器。
  • 稳定性:选择提供商信誉良好的服务器。
  • 地理位置:根据需要选择不同地区的服务器。

Shadowsocks与VPN的区别是什么?

  • 协议:Shadowsocks使用的是代理协议,而VPN使用的是虚拟专用网络协议。
  • 速度:一般来说,Shadowsocks的速度会比VPN快。
  • 安全性:VPN通常提供更全面的安全保护,而Shadowsocks主要用于绕过网络限制。

如何解决Shadowsocks连接失败的问题?

  • 检查服务器地址和端口是否正确。
  • 确保网络连接正常。
  • 尝试更换服务器或重新启动客户端。

结论

Shadowsocks 是一个强大且灵活的科学上网工具,适合需要绕过网络限制的用户。通过正确的安装和配置,用户可以安全、快速地访问互联网。希望本文能帮助你更好地理解和使用Shadowsocks。

正文完
 0